The article is devoted to assessing the effectiveness of drug and non-drug treatment of tobacco dependence in health care workers.</p></sec><sec><title>Material and methods</title><p>Material and methods. The study included 621 medical workers (237 men and 384 women) working in hospitals in Moscow, at the average age of 48.3 ± 5.6 years, including 207 doctors and 414 nurses. The medical workers were divided into 2 groups depending on the anti-smoking program used. The first group consisted of 316 medical workers who received non-drug methods of treatment: psychosocial support, using cognitive aspects; psychotherapy; breathing exercises; acupuncture; increase physical activity. The second group consisted of 305 medical workers who, in addition to non-drug methods (described above), received Varenicline treatment (Champix® - tablets) and, if necessary, nicotine replacement therapy.</p></sec><sec><title>Results</title><p>Results. In medical workers from the 2nd group, besides non-pharmacological therapy, received the drug Varenicline, 195 out of 305 (64%) persons completely stopped smoking; In the 1st group of Medical workers receiving non-drug therapy, 177 out of 316 (56% ) cases completely quit smoking (OR= 1.40; 95% CI: 1.01-1.93; р=0.0423). 6 months after the end of the treatment program, in the first group 84 (26.7%) medical workers) in the 2nd group - 31 medical workers (10.2%) restarted smoking, (OR=3.02, 95% CI: 2.05-5.02; р&lt;0.00001).</p></sec><sec><title>Conclusion</title><p>Conclusion. Thus, the antismoking program, including drug Varenicline and, if necessary, nicotine-replacement therapy, as well as non-drug effects, including psycho-social support; psychotherapy; breathing exercises; acupuncture; an increase in physical activity showed higher efficacy compared with the antismoking program without Varenicline, moreover, high efficacy remained even after the treatment carried out for 6 months.</p></sec></trans-abstract><kwd-group xml:lang="ru"><kwd>табакокурение</kwd><kwd>медицинские работники</kwd><kwd>антисмокинговая программа</kwd></kwd-group><kwd-group xml:lang="en"><kwd>smoking</kwd><kwd>medical workers</kwd><kwd>antismoking program</kwd></kwd-group></article-meta></front><back><ref-list><title>References</title><ref id="cit1"><label>1</label><citation-alternatives><mixed-citation xml:lang="ru">Глобальный опрос взрослого населения о потреблении табака (GATS) в Российской Федерации 2016 года.
